Let's step back and consider what our goal is here: to provide a spec
that someone wanting to implement a driver can follow and end up with a
driver that works with devices that adhere to this spec.

I don't think expecting the driver to make "wise descisions" is helpful
for the person wanting to implement a driver. "Do this, and in case this
does not work in your environment, do that" seems much more helpful, and
still gives enough flexibility to cover different environments. In
short, make things simple for the consumer of the spec.
